    CINCINNATI REDS +126: The Atlanta Braves shut out the Cincinnati Reds 2-0 last night as Tim Hudson outdueled Edinson Volquez, but we don’t expect similar performances from tonight’s starters. If the starters do not stick around long tonight, we feel that the pitching edge would shift to Cincinnati at this nice price, as the Reds qualify as one of our Bullpen System plays here. Cincinnati ranks eighth in the Major Leagues in bullpen ERA at 3.27, while the Atlanta pen is languishing at 4.14. This is not to say that Reds starter Matt Belisle is not capable of a good effort, as he is erratic and could turn in a fine performance at any time. He has been terrible in two starts so far though. Jo-Jo Reyes is making his seasonal debut for the Braves, and he too was erratic for Atlanta last season. He did not pitch well in his two outings against the Reds however, as he was roughed up for nine earned runs while allowing 18 baserunners in just nine total innings, averaging less than five innings per start. Thus, the shaky Atlanta bullpen may be called on early here.

    BAL +113
    Orioles beat the Angels in the series opener and send perhaps their most consistent starter to the hill today in Daniel Cabrera. Cabrera has surrendered two ER or less in his last four starts and the O's are 5-0-1 in his starts this season. Jon Garland is fresh of being spanked by the A's in his last start and he's given up 16 ER in 3 home starts with two resulting in big losses for the Angels.
